Singer Jake Flint dies at 37, just hours after his wedding


The country singer died in his sleep just hours after getting hitched. Photo: Jake Flint

Country singer Jake Flint died just hours after he walked down the aisle. He was 37.

Flint married fiancee Brenda on Nov 26. He died in his sleep hours later, his publicist said.

“I can confirm that Jake died in his sleep sometime in the night following his wedding. No cause of death has been determined,” publicist Clif Doyal told NBC News on Monday.

The singer’s widow shared a video of their wedding shortly after the news of his death.

She wrote: “I don't understand ... people aren't meant to feel this much pain..

“We should be going through wedding photos but instead I have to pick out clothes to bury my husband in.

“My heart is gone and I just really need him to come back. I can't take much more. I need him here."
